  1. Evernote has forced my hand but it's a good outcome, I've discovered an alternative that better fits my needs and that is Joplin. For those interested, Joplin is open source and provides an option to self-host which is exactly what I was looking for. I like the idea that I retain my data within my environment. Added bonus is the workflow and layout is almost identical to Evernote so it makes for an easy switch!
